Apollon Library Suites - Nafpaktos
38.39212, 21.82636The 3-star Apollon Library Suites Nafpaktos hotel, located nearly 5 minutes' walk from The Statue of Cervantes, features a terrace and various recreational opportunities.
Location
This Nafpaktos aparthotel is approximately 5 minutes' walk from Botsaris Museum, really close to Faraggi Kakavou. At the property you'll be approximately 5 minutes' walk from Psani. Also, the hotel is a 15-minute ride from Calma water park.
Multirama bus stop is near the accommodation.
Rooms
Apollon Library Suites hotel features 9 rooms with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, as well as tea and coffee making equipment. They are outfitted with spacious decor. A walk-in shower, along with such amenities as bathrobes, are also at guests' disposal. You can enjoy views of the inner courtyard.
Eat & Drink
This Nafpaktos hotel offers breakfast in the restaurant. The seafood restaurant Captain Cook is around 400 metres from the property.
